Diving into blockchain scalability, we see Layer 2 solutions like Lightning Network and state channels, promising faster transactions without straining the main chain. Meanwhile, sidechains and sharding offer parallel processing power, enhancing throughput. Each approach has tradeoffs—security, compatibility, and complexity. Which path will surf through the blockchain bottleneck?
